TOMATO-CUCUMBER-ONION SALAD 2 medium cucumbers 2 large tomatoes 1 large sweet onion 1 tsp. dill weed (or 2 Tbsp. fresh dill) 2 Tbsp. oil (or less) 1 1/2 Tbsp. vinegar or lemon juice 1 1/2 tsp. sugar dash of white pepper Peel or partially peel cucumbers and cut into 1/8-inch thick slices. Slice tomatoes. Cut onion into very thin slices. Layer cucumber, onion and tomato slices in a shallow serving dish. Repeat layers. Combine dill, oil, vinegar, sugar and pepper. Heat slightly to melt sugar. Cool and pour over vegetables. Chill. Best if prepared ahead. Serves 6 to 8.
